Can your cervix be slightly open in early pregnancy? … WebEarly in pregnancy, many women have pelvic pain. Pelvic pain refers to pain in the lowest part of the torso, in the area below the abdomen and between the hipbones (pelvis). The pain may be sharp or crampy (like menstrual cramps) and may come and go. It may be sudden and excruciating, dull and constant, or some combination.

WebNov 19, 2024 · However, it’s hard to distinguish between the changes that occur due to impending ovulation and pregnancy. So, checking your cervix is not a definitive way to tell if you’re pregnant. Other symptoms, such as breast tenderness, nausea, tiredness, and lack of a period, are more noticeable and reliable in early pregnancy.
